I bought his TM glock 26. Here is a screenshot of the ad in case he edits it: http://i.imgur.com/VfGyTfH.png As you can see, his ad states it comes with a G26 magazine, a TM 17 mag, and a WE 17 mag. The only one I believe is the G26 magazine. Here is a picture of the 3 mags included with the gun, along with a WE G17 Co2 magazine I own. Labelled for clarity: http://i.imgur.com/BiD96fx.jpg?1 The two magazines in the middle, which in the ad says are "17 mags" are about a half inch shorter than an actual G17 magazine, as you can tell from the magazine on the far right. The ad says one of those in the middle is "TM". It has a Tokyo Marui base plate, but I believe it to be a KJW glock magazine. The finish on that particular magazine does not match that of most TM glock magazines, and is glossy. Other than that, it is clearly a size of magazine that TM doesn't even make. As for the gun itself, there are a couple problems. First of all, it's missing the silver safety bar on the lower frame, pictured here: http://i.imgur.com/x85jwzz.jpg That wasn't stated in the ad. Also not stated in the ad, the trigger is always in a reset position. Whoever is reading this may know that a TM glock trigger only resets completely when the gun is cocked, with this particular gun I was sold the trigger is always in a reset position. Pulling the trigger always has a sort of non-typical click sound to it. I haven't tested the gun itself, and I have brought my concerns up to the seller.
